On-Demand: Fireside Chat with Esteemed 2022 WIN Awards Winners
Tamara Vrooman (Outstanding Leader), Clair Seaborn (Emerging Leader), and Monique Lal (Emerging Leader) discuss their successes and challenges working in infrastructure, and share their thoughts on what needs to be done to achieve gender diversity in the industry.
On January 17, 2023, we hosted a virtual session with the winners of the 8th Annual WIN Awards. Tamara Vrooman (Outstanding Leader), Clair Seaborn (Emerging Leader), and Monique Lal (Emerging Leader) discussed their successes and challenges working in infrastructure, and shared their thoughts on what needs to be done to achieve gender diversity in the industry.
